Original Description
Jacques Guillaume Lucien Amans' Portrait of a Creole Girl in White is a captivating example of 19th-century Creole portraiture, radiating both elegance and quiet introspection. The painting depicts a young Creole woman dressed in a luminous white gown, her serene expression and poised demeanor reflecting the refined social status of New Orleans' mixed-race elite during the antebellum period. Amans, a French neoclassical painter who flourished in Louisiana, employs delicate brushwork and a soft, naturalistic palette to highlight the sitter's graceful features and the intricate details of her attire—lace trimmings, pearl earrings, and an elaborate hairstyle. The muted background ensures the viewer's focus remains on her dignified presence, embodying Creole identity and cultural pride. This work holds significance in art history as a rare representation of free women of color in the pre-Civil War South, challenging stereotypes and offering a glimpse into their genteel world.
